Crawlspace foundation repair services focus on addressing issues beneath a building's structure, specifically targeting problems within the crawlspace area. These services typically involve inspecting the foundation, identifying causes of damage or instability, and implementing solutions such as reinforcing or leveling the foundation, installing new supports, or sealing gaps and cracks. Proper repair work helps ensure the stability of the entire structure, preventing further deterioration and safeguarding the property's integrity over time.
Many common problems that crawlspace foundation repair services help resolve include uneven flooring, sagging or cracked walls, and excessive moisture or water intrusion. These issues often stem from soil movement, poor drainage, or wood rot, which can compromise the foundation's stability. Repair professionals may also address issues related to pests or mold that thrive in damp environments, providing solutions that improve the overall condition of the crawlspace and reduce the risk of future damage.

The overview below groups typical Crawlspace Foundation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Prescott, WI.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Foundation Repair Costs - Typical expenses for crawlspace foundation repair range from $1,500 to $5,000, depending on the extent of the damage and necessary repairs. For example, minor leveling may cost around $1,500, while extensive underpinning could reach $5,000 or more.
Labor and Materials - Labor costs usually account for a significant portion of the total, often between $500 and $2,500. Material costs, including piers or supports, can add another $1,000 to $3,000 based on the repair scope.
Factors Affecting Cost - The overall cost varies with factors such as foundation size, soil conditions, and accessibility. Repairs in areas like Prescott, WI, may typically fall within the $2,000 to $4,000 range for standard projects.
Additional Expenses - Additional costs might include permits or inspections, which can range from $100 to $500. It’s recommended to contact local pros to get detailed estimates tailored to specific foundation issues.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s of crawlspace foundation issues? Indicators include uneven floors, sagging or cracked walls, musty odors, and visible mold or moisture problems in the crawlspace area.
How do professionals typically repair crawlspace foundations? Repair methods may involve underpinning, installing support jacks, sealing vents, or applying waterproofing solutions, depending on the specific issue.
Is crawlspace foundation repair disruptive to my home? The extent of disruption varies based on the repair method and the condition of the foundation; a local contractor can provide details during an assessment.
Can crawlspace foundation problems lead to other home issues? Yes, issues with the foundation can cause structural damage, mold growth, and increased energy costs due to poor insulation.
